Output 86ab6691fecffdce3d2c1a16b653f572562785305d0d768a923b548daf69f5b8:0

value
12850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 64eb61d913a5ef733703aeff72f78662c4a013dafdc27c4c9a1993a753bc458d
address
tb1pvn4krkgn5hhhxdcr4mlh9auxvtz2qy76lhp8cny6rxf6w5augkxszygwsq
transaction
86ab6691fecffdce3d2c1a16b653f572562785305d0d768a923b548daf69f5b8
confirmations
28092
spent
true